LUBBOCK, TX (February 29, 2024) – Sunday evening, a motorcycle accident on 82nd Avenue left Cody Worley and Efrem Romero hurt.
The incident occurred around 9:30 p.m., near Frankford Avenue.
Per reports, 35-year-old Romero was driving a passenger sedan when he attempted to turn left at the intersection and struck the Worley on a motorcycle.
Responding medical personnel transported Worley to UMC for treatment of life-threatening injuries.
Meanwhile, Romero suffered only minor injuries. At this time, the police have not released any additional information regarding the accident. An active investigation is underway.
